A c# library wrapping native Windows wlan api (wlanapi.dll)
This was my small project I did while learning P/Invoke in C#.
I am aiming to wrap whole wlanapi.dll (native Windows Wi-Fi API) in easy to use C# library.
As for now there is a set of classes to use Hosted Access Point.
As this is my first project I decided to publish, any pointers, advice or constructive criticism is welcome.
This is just an example application demonstrating use of a library I have created (https://sourceforge.net/projects/wirelessapi/).
I have tested it on my Windows 8 machine, I can't guarantee it will work on Windows XP (windows API has changed since).
A command-line windows application to manage wireless network connections, cards and profiles. Connect to WLANs, query for RSSI, stadistics... It can be used as an example of how to use Microsoft Native Wifi API dlls from any ANSI C compatible IDE
The API enables applications running on Windows XP Service Pack1 (SP1), Windows XP Service Pack2 (SP2) and Windows CE, to securely access Wi-Fi networks. The API consists of several MS modules, which include WZC API, WPS, NDIS and Windows Registry.
